Fallon Community Health Plan to present Movies in the Park in Worcester
Now on Thursdays!
Worcester, Mass., May 24, 2007―Fallon Community Health Plan (FCHP) is proud to present the fourth annual Movies in the Park series this August at Institute Park, Salisbury St., in Worcester. Families and people of all ages are invited to join FCHP for free movies and popcorn under the stars. Moviegoers are welcome to bring a blanket, lawn chair and picnic basket, and are invited to participate in giveaways and activities for the kids.
Schedule for Movies in the Park
August 9 – “Over the Hedge”
August 16 – “Harry Potter and the Goblet of Fire”
August 23 – “The Goonies”
“It’s great to hear that Fallon Community Health Plan is once again bringing Movies in the Park to Worcester,” said Michael V. O’Brien, Worcester City Manager. “This event provides a fun, free evening out for families with the opportunity to enjoy wonderful movies at one of our most beautiful parks.”
“At FCHP, we felt that it was important to bring Movies in the Park back to Worcester for another year,” said Eric H. Schultz, President and CEO, FCHP. “So many cities and towns like these have events that bring the community together, and we’re looking forward to watching these wonderful movies with our friends, family and neighbors this summer.”
The park opens at 6 p.m. for families to pick their spot! Movies will be shown shortly after dark, between 7:30 and 8:00 p.m. Rain date is the Friday evening after the movie is scheduled to be shown.

About FCHP
Founded in 1977, Fallon Community Health Plan provides health care services designed to meet the unique and changing needs of all we serve. FCHP is the only health plan in Massachusetts that is both an insurer and provider of care. Our insurance and self-insurance product portfolio includes a variety of group and non-group health plan options (HMO, POS, PPO, as well as Medicaid and Medicare Advantage plans) featuring flexible and innovative benefit designs. Our uniquely developed provider networks offer high-quality, cost-effective, coordinated care and give our members access to physicians and hospitals throughout Massachusetts. We also offer a broad spectrum of health and wellness services and programs to ensure our members, at every stage of life, remain as healthy and productive as possible. As a provider of care, FCHP operates an advanced and completely integrated program that offers seniors and their caregivers an alternative to nursing home care. Our continued commitment to deliver high-quality health care and exceptional customer service has earned FCHP consistent ratings as one of the nation's top health plans. Both our commercial HMO and Medicare Advantage plans have been awarded "Excellent" accreditation by the National Committee for Quality Assurance.
